Utility function

A utility function is a mathematical expression that assigns a value to all possible choices. In portfolio theory the utility function expresses the preferences of economic entities with respect to perceived risk and expected return.

Similar financial terms

Utility value
The welfare a given investor assigns to an investment with a particular return and risk.

Utility
The measure of the welfare or satisfaction of an investor or person.

Probability function
A function that assigns a probability to each and every possible outcome.

Probability density function
The probability function for a continuous random variable.
